沙箱环境要先获取沙箱密钥,后续所有调用签名都是用沙箱密钥签名,感觉你是没获取沙箱密钥
沙箱环境:签名校验工具校验通过,接口调用验证签名失败https://pay.weixin.qq.com/wiki/doc/api/native.php?chapter=20_1 在这个地址里面验证 校验通过。校验通过 但是请求接口:https://api.mch.weixin.qq.com/sandboxnew/pay/unifiedorder 验证失败。 <xml> <return_code><![CDATA[FAIL]]></return_code> <return_msg><![CDATA[沙箱验证签名失败,请确认沙箱签名key是否正确(通过getsignkey调用生成)]]></return_msg> </xml>
2021-05-10先下载平台证书,你给的是商户证书,显然不对
微信V3 应答的微信支付签名验证失败[图片] [图片] 按文档传参,就返回“应答的微信支付签名验证失败“ ,不知什么原因
2021-05-10查一下 prepay_id=u802345jgfjsdfgsdg888 肉眼从这个串上看,不像是常见场景的,常见是wx开头的,你这个是u开头的,建议让后端查询下这个的预支付用的场景值是多少。
微信支付jsapi微信打开提示非法场景 求助[图片]用的以下代码 微信打开的时候提示支付非法场景 求助是哪里的问题 function onBridgeReady(){ WeixinJSBridge.invoke( 'getBrandWCPayRequest', { "appId":"wx5b1087966d2b95cf", //公众号名称,由商户传入 "timeStamp":"1395712654", //时间戳,自1970年以来的秒数 "nonceStr":"r72ywo30clrh3u3mp1si6ighxn8qyll9", //随机串 "package":"prepay_id=wx1001010425347501c8cf35b02bf6c20000", "signType":"MD5", //微信签名方式: "paySign":"90329A9CA8869996A225F9343184CB08" //微信签名 }, function(res){ if(res.err_msg == "get_brand_wcpay_request:ok" ){ // 使用以上方式判断前端返回,微信团队郑重提示: //res.err_msg将在用户支付成功后返回ok,但并不保证它绝对可靠。 } }); } if (typeof WeixinJSBridge == "undefined"){ if( document.addEventListener ){ document.addEventListener('WeixinJSBridgeReady', onBridgeReady, false); }else if (document.attachEvent){ document.attachEvent('WeixinJSBridgeReady', onBridgeReady); document.attachEvent('onWeixinJSBridgeReady', onBridgeReady); } }else{ onBridgeReady(); }
2021-05-10下单接口文档: https://pay.weixin.qq.com/wiki/doc/apiv3/apis/chapter3_1_1.shtml 用小程序appid去下单获取prepay_id;然后再数据签名给小程序端唤起支付,文档 https://pay.weixin.qq.com/wiki/doc/apiv3/apis/chapter3_1_4.shtml
微信小程序唤起支付时报商户传入的appid不正确,请联系商户处理?非服务商模式1.获取微信平调用下单接口台证书https://api.mch.weixin.qq.com/v3/certificates,使用支付appid和apiv3key 2.下单接口https://api.mch.weixin.qq.com/v3/paydocpc/apiv3/apis/chapter3_1_4.shtml取预支付流水号 3.jsapi唤醒支付,api链接https://pay.weixin.qq.com/wiki/doc/apiv3/apis/chapter3_1_4.shtml,使用的是支付appid非小程序appid,商户号两个appid都绑定了
2021-05-10预付卡资质和银行牌照一样,都是监管并审核制,个人工商户做不了这个。
个体工商户可以做预付卡备案?想开通卡券里的储值功能,请问个体工商户可以做预付卡备案? [图片] [图片]
2021-05-09谢邀。移动端应用设置像素是会有偏差,一般用rpx单位;如果非得用px单位,建议读取 https://developers.weixin.qq.com/miniprogram/dev/api/base/system/system-info/wx.getSystemInfoSync.html pixelRatio 的值作为除数
用canvas组件开发签名功能,设置canvas的宽高时发现宽高实际上只是根据宽高缩放?使用canvas开发签名功能,调整宽高时发现会根据宽300px高150px缩放。 比如我不设置宽高使用默认的w:300px,h:150px时正常 当我设置h为300px时画出来的距离就会是两倍需要除以二才正常 代码片段https://developers.weixin.qq.com/s/o7vX4amu7gqt [图片] [图片] 希望大神们解答,谢谢!!!!!!!!!!!!!!
2021-05-09不好好看文档,唉,咋说你呢。。。你填「name: 小程序」怎么能行?? https://pay.weixin.qq.com/wiki/doc/api/allocation.php?chapter=27_3&index=4 分账接收方类型是MERCHANT_ID时,是商户全称(必传),当商户是小微商户或个体户时,是开户人姓名分账接收方类型是PERSONAL_OPENID时,是个人姓名(选传,传则校验)
求助,分账功能,添加分账接收方签名总是失败签名原串 :appid=xxx&mch_id=xxx&nonce_str=5186d12965324a0e875f75d9acdbc611&receiver={"account":"xxx","name":"小程序","relation_type":"PARTNER","type":"MERCHANT_ID"}&key=B1E00C7752444B49A338C278CB338BDF xml : <xml><appid>xxx</appid><mch_id>xxx</mch_id><nonce_str>5186d12965324a0e875f75d9acdbc611</nonce_str><receiver>{"account":"xxx","name":"小程序","relation_type":"PARTNER","type":"MERCHANT_ID"}</receiver><sign>E6EC3F2CC1038F7BD4347FDAA7A017897F0CB3FDA569126C386C518634467302</sign></xml> 在微信签名工具验证都是通过的(sha256签名),但是远程调用的时候死活报验证签名失败。对比签名的5条规则,都符合啊。
2021-05-09开户邮件仅是个“通知”类的提示,类似短信通知,没有太多重收查阅价值;不过,仍旧建议在帐户中心里,把邮箱地址维护准确,类似风险提示等,有邮件通知可阅还是会保险许多
微信开户邮件未收到?可以重发吗?虽然微信支付已经开户成功了。但是开户邮件未收到?可以重发吗? 微信支付商户号 1608474674
2021-05-08谢邀,建议用官方PHP v3开发包,少走弯路
PHP V3接口 申请退款 一直报 Http头缺少Accept或User-Agent?请求接口: https://api.mch.weixin.qq.com/v3/refund/domestic/refunds 这是打印的header信息[图片] 一直报 {"code":"INVALID_REQUEST","message":"Http头缺少Accept或User-Agent"}
2021-05-08不可以,微信环境会检测当前场景的appid是否匹配,绕不去,建议放弃这个想法,老老实实按规范做。
服务商小程序支付,是否可以使用同主体其他小程序的appid?我在A小程序用的商户是关联B小程序的,返回给前端调起,报appid不正确
2021-05-08